If the equation $\lambda x^2 + 4xy + y^2 + \lambda x + 3y + 2 = 0$ represents a parabola.
Then find $\lambda$.

Your conic is a parabola if $B^2 - 4AC = 0$ with $B = 4$, $C = 1$, and $A = \lambda$. Thus: $4^2 - 4\lambda = 0$, giving $\lambda = 4$
